Output 7126bfaeda24cfdc64b04efa0cecc9376f60e6edf13330fd263d5de4940f4d24:4

value
522760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8583cdbdffdb7698930ea7a2965e1066ffbc3ac OP_EQUAL
address
3MQwaqumLfVGyQcPDwdaoStNsR3qj6FADy
transaction
7126bfaeda24cfdc64b04efa0cecc9376f60e6edf13330fd263d5de4940f4d24
spent
true